Why Use Denture Adhesive?

Denture adhesive is a creamy or powder substance that you put on your dentures. It creates a sticky layer between your dentures and your gums. This extra hold helps prevent your dentures from moving around when you eat, talk, or laugh. It can also help create a seal that stops food particles from getting under your dentures.

No Zinc

While zinc was once common in denture adhesives, many dentists now recommend zinc-free options. Too much zinc can be harmful over time. Always check the ingredients list.

Important Materials

Denture adhesives are typically made from a few key ingredients. These ingredients work together to create the sticky and holding properties:

  • Cellulose Gum (Carboxymethylcellulose): This is a common ingredient that helps thicken the adhesive and make it sticky. It’s water-soluble, which makes it easy to clean.
  • Petroleum Jelly (Petrolatum): This ingredient helps create a barrier and provides a smooth texture.
  • Mineral Oil: This also helps with texture and spreadability.
  • Silica: This is often used as a thickening agent and to improve the texture.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Several things can make a denture adhesive work better or worse:

What Improves Quality:
  • Freshness: Make sure the product is not expired. Old adhesive might not hold as well.
  • Proper Application: Using the right amount is key. Too little won’t hold, and too much can ooze out. Follow the product’s instructions.
  • Clean Dentures: Apply adhesive to clean, dry dentures. This helps it stick better.
  • Good Denture Fit: Denture adhesive works best when your dentures already fit reasonably well. If your dentures are very loose, even the best adhesive might not be enough.
What Reduces Quality:
  • Moisture: Applying adhesive to wet dentures can weaken the bond.
  • Over-application: Using too much adhesive can make it messy and less effective.
  • Eating or Drinking Too Soon: Give the adhesive time to set before eating or drinking.
  • Certain Foods: Very sticky or oily foods can sometimes break down the adhesive faster.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How often should I apply denture adhesive?

A: Most people apply denture adhesive once a day. It’s best to apply it in the morning. You usually don’t need to reapply it throughout the day.

Q: Can I use denture adhesive if my dentures are very loose?

A: Denture adhesive can help with slightly loose dentures. However, if your dentures are very loose or uncomfortable, it’s important to see your dentist. They can adjust or reline your dentures for a better fit.

Q: How do I remove denture adhesive?

A: To remove denture adhesive, swish your mouth with warm water. Then, gently remove your dentures. You can usually wipe off any remaining adhesive from your dentures with a soft cloth or toothbrush and warm water.

Q: Is it safe to use denture adhesive every day?

A: Yes, it is generally safe to use denture adhesive every day as long as you choose a zinc-free product and follow the instructions. If you have any concerns, talk to your dentist.

Q: What is the best way to apply denture adhesive?

A: Make sure your dentures are clean and dry. Apply small strips or dots of adhesive to the areas of the denture that will touch your gums. Don’t use too much. Then, press your dentures firmly into place and bite down for a few seconds.

Q: Can denture adhesive help with sore gums?

A: Some denture adhesives can create a cushioning effect that might offer some relief from minor gum irritation. However, if you have persistent sore gums, you should consult your dentist.

Q: How long does denture adhesive usually last?

A: The hold typically lasts for about 10 to 12 hours, but this can vary depending on the product and what you eat or drink.

Q: Can I use denture adhesive with a denture cleaner?

A: Yes, you should clean your dentures thoroughly every night with a denture cleaner and remove all traces of adhesive. This helps keep your dentures and gums healthy.

Q: Are there different types of denture adhesives?

A: Yes, denture adhesives come in creams, powders, and strips. Each type has its own way of applying and holding. Creams are the most common, powders can be good for absorbing moisture, and strips offer a convenient, mess-free option.

Q: What should I do if I have an allergic reaction to denture adhesive?

A: If you experience any signs of an allergic reaction, such as itching, redness, or swelling in your mouth, stop using the product immediately and consult your dentist or doctor.
